Системный объект: comm.CoarseFrequencyCompensator
Пакет: comm
Компенсируйте смещение частоты
Y = step(CFC,X)
[Y,EST] = step(CFC,X)
Примечание
Начиная с R2016b, вместо использования step
метод для выполнения операции, заданной Системной object™, можно вызвать объект с аргументами, как если бы это была функция. Для примера, y = step(obj,x)
и y = obj(x)
выполнять эквивалентные операции.
Y = step(CFC,X)
компенсирует смещение частоты несущего входа X
и возвращает результат в Y
. X
должен быть вектор-столбец. Шаговый метод выводит компенсированный сигнал Y
как комплексный вектор-столбец, имеющий те же размерности и тип данных, что и X
.
[Y,EST] = step(CFC,X)
возвращает скалярную оценку смещения частоты, EST
.
Примечание
CFC
задает системный объект, на котором будет выполняться эта step
способ.
Объект выполняет инициализацию при первом step
выполняется метод. Эта инициализация блокирует нетронутые свойства и входные спецификации, такие как размерности, сложность и тип данных входных данных. Если вы изменяете свойство nontunable или спецификацию входа, системный объект выдает ошибку. Чтобы изменить нетронутые свойства или входы, необходимо сначала вызвать release
метод для разблокировки объекта.